Chernobylite is a game that truly captures the eerie atmosphere and sense of dread that comes with exploring the haunting ruins of the Chernobyl Exclusion Zone. Developed by The Farm 51, this survival horror experience takes players on a thrilling journey through a post-apocalyptic world filled with danger and mystery.
One of the standout features of Chernobylite is its attention to detail when it comes to recreating the Chernobyl Zone. The game uses real-life photographs and references to create an authentic and immersive environment. The desolate landscapes, crumbling buildings, and radioactive hotspots are all faithfully recreated, making you feel like you're truly exploring a post-disaster area.
The gameplay in Chernobylite is a delicate balance of survival, horror, and exploration. As the protagonist, you'll have to scavenge for resources, manage your inventory, and craft items to survive the harsh environment. The game also features a unique system called the "Zone of Exclusion", where time and space become distorted, adding an element of uncertainty and tension to the gameplay.
One of the strengths of Chernobylite is its narrative. The game weaves a complex and intriguing story, blending elements of science fiction, horror, and mystery. As you progress through the game, you'll uncover the truth behind the Chernobyl disaster and the events that followed. The characters are well-written and the voice acting is generally impressive, adding to the immersive experience.
However, Chernobylite is not without its flaws. The game suffers from occasional technical issues, such as frame rate drops and glitches. While these issues don't significantly detract from the overall experience, they can be frustrating at times. Additionally, some players may find the gameplay repetitive, as a significant portion of the game involves exploring and scavenging for resources.
Overall, Chernobylite offers a captivating and atmospheric survival horror experience that is sure to please fans of the genre. The attention to detail, immersive environment, and intriguing narrative make it a standout title. However, the occasional technical issues and repetitive gameplay may hinder the experience for some. Despite these flaws, Chernobylite is a game that deserves recognition for its ambition and ability to create a truly haunting and atmospheric world.
